How To Know If Your Online Relationship Might Be A Successful One.

01 September 2020, 17:19 admin

Did you know that one in five romantic relationships begin online today? That’s true for the citizens of the United Kingdom, and what’s even more impressive is that half the people in the country have searched for love online at some point. While these are known, what is not known is whether or not online dating can in fact lead to true and everlasting love. It is more than obvious that it can lead to a relationship, but is this a relationship that is just failed to doom, or is this a relationship that will stand up beyond all? Can this even be determined? Believe it or not, a recent study shows that there are certain factors that can determine whether an online relationship will be a successful one or not. What are these factors and how do they apply to your current relationship?

The Meeting Place

Despite what you might think, the site or app that you meet your potential mate on could make all the difference in the world. How is this possible and why would it even matter? That’s an excellent question, and it seems that it has something to do with common interests. It’s really quite simple when you sit down and think about it. As online dating has improved and technology’s gotten better more and more dating sites have started dedicating their designs to particular subjects. Take demographics, for example. A lot of dating sites and apps are tailored for specific demographics these days. If they aren’t designed for demographics then they were certainly designed for people with particular interests and like minds.

This is important because other research shows that people are more attracted to others who are similar to them. It’s simply like finding someone with similar interests. The likelihood that you’ll get along and be more successful is just higher. There goes the theory of opposites attract. Delayed Meeting

When meeting someone online there is a huge emphasis placed on an online meeting. Sure, this is the eventual end goal and a lot of experts might tell you to rush this stage as fast as possible because you can’t know if you truly mesh until you meet online. This could be possibly true, but it could also hurt your relationship’s chances of longevity. How? It could possibly have something to do with the limitation of more meaningful communication. It might have something to do with the distractions of physicality. Whatever the situation is, one recent survey of couples who met online and later married showed that they interact for more than two months before meeting face-to-face.

When you meet someone online, they’ll likely be located in a different state or a different area. To say the least, they’ll likely be some commute between the two of you, which usually hinders face-to-face interaction. Simply put, there causes more barriers, barriers that will give the two of you time to chat and get to know each other better. Just because there is no rush to meeting in-person, it doesn’t mean that your relationship is doomed. In fact, it could be one of the many signs of success.
